Really!! But they are lovely, all in bloom and everything. I particularly like the blue ones. Huge blooms. I just can't help wondering though, how they would be for transfering outside when it's warmer. I suppose they would be ok after hardening off and everything. But Hydrangeas don't normally bloom outside until July & August. These were obviously forced, but I wonder if they'd bloom outside again this summer?

The ones coming into the Greenhouse right now (we get our stuff from Kelowna) were all grown outside and the sprouts are just beginning to pop up on a few of them. Mine still don't have anything showing yet, but it is a bit early.

Your so lucky being able to grow them in the ground. For me they will be container plants year round, that makes it easier to control the PH for coloring. I am really interested in taking cuttings of them. Here is a link on caring for them.Take care, Joelle

Winnipeg,, MB(Zone 3a)

Joelle
No my son has borrowed it,,
and not really any hints I just bring them in the house in the fall and keep them in my cool basement in the winter.. and they do flower for me in the summer time..
